study guides for every class

that actually explain what's on your next test

Secure storage

from class:

Advanced Computer Architecture

Definition

Secure storage refers to methods and technologies designed to protect sensitive data from unauthorized access, loss, or corruption. It ensures that information, whether in transit or at rest, is safeguarded through encryption, access controls, and trusted environments. This concept is closely tied to secure boot and trusted execution environments, which provide a foundation for maintaining the integrity and confidentiality of data throughout the computing process.

congrats on reading the definition of secure storage.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Secure storage often employs encryption algorithms to protect data at rest, making it unreadable without the proper keys.
  2. In the context of secure boot, secure storage can store cryptographic keys that validate the authenticity of the operating system and applications during the startup process.
  3. Trusted execution environments utilize secure storage for sensitive operations, ensuring that critical data is processed securely even if the main operating system is compromised.
  4. Secure storage is essential for compliance with data protection regulations, as it helps prevent data breaches and unauthorized access to personal information.
  5. Physical security measures are also vital for secure storage, as hardware components can be susceptible to tampering and theft if not properly protected.

Review Questions

  • How does secure storage relate to both secure boot and trusted execution environments?
    • Secure storage plays a crucial role in both secure boot and trusted execution environments by safeguarding sensitive data used during these processes. In secure boot, it stores cryptographic keys that verify the integrity of the software being loaded at startup. In trusted execution environments, secure storage protects critical data and ensures that computations performed in isolation remain confidential and tamper-proof, even when the main operating system may be compromised.
  • Discuss the importance of encryption in secure storage and how it enhances data protection during the secure boot process.
    • Encryption is vital in secure storage as it transforms sensitive information into an unreadable format without the correct keys. During the secure boot process, encrypted data ensures that only verified software components are loaded, preventing unauthorized modifications. By utilizing encryption, devices can maintain their integrity from the very beginning of their operation, thereby enhancing overall security against potential threats.
  • Evaluate the implications of inadequate secure storage practices on data integrity and compliance with security standards.
    • Inadequate secure storage practices can lead to significant risks regarding data integrity and compliance with security standards. If sensitive information is not properly protected through encryption or access controls, it becomes vulnerable to breaches and unauthorized access. This not only compromises the confidentiality of critical data but also exposes organizations to legal penalties for failing to comply with regulations such as GDPR or HIPAA. Ultimately, poor secure storage practices undermine trust in systems and could lead to catastrophic financial and reputational damage.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.